/* @override 
	https://my-lemonda-flywheel.local/wp-content/themes/lemonada/assets/css/accordian_menu.css?* */

	.accordion {
		width: 100%;
		margin: 0;
		background: #FFF;
		-webkit-border-radius: 4px;
		-moz-border-radius: 4px;
		border-radius: 4px;
		list-style: none;
		padding: 0;
		overflow-y: scroll;
	}

	.accordion .link {
		font-family: 'neue_montrealmedium';
		cursor: pointer;
		display: block;
		padding: 15px 15px 15px 0;
		border-bottom: 1px solid #ddd;
		position: relative;
		-webkit-transition: all 0.4s ease;
		-o-transition: all 0.4s ease;
		transition: all 0.4s ease;
	}

/*.accordion li:last-child .link { border-bottom: 0; }*/

.accordion li i {
	position: absolute;
	top: 16px;
	left: 12px;
	font-size: 18px;
	color: #595959;
	-webkit-transition: all 0.4s ease;
	-o-transition: all 0.4s ease;
	transition: all 0.4s ease;
}

.accordion li i.fa-chevron-down {
	right: 12px;
	left: auto;
	font-size: 16px;
	/*  background: #FBED21;*/
	border-radius: 50%;
	width: 30px;
	height: 30px;
	display: flex;
	justify-content: center;
	align-items: center;
}

.accordion li.open .link {
	color: #000;
}

.accordion li.open i {
	color: #000;
}

.accordion li.open i.fa-chevron-down {
	-webkit-transform: rotate(180deg);
	-ms-transform: rotate(180deg);
	-o-transform: rotate(180deg);
	transform: rotate(180deg);
}

/**
 * Submenu
 -----------------------------*/

 .submenu {
 	display: none;
 	font-size: 14px;
 	list-style: none;
 	padding: 0;
 	margin-bottom: 0;
 }

/*.submenu li { border-bottom: 1px solid #DDDDDD; }*/

.submenu a {
	font-family: 'neue_montrealmedium';
	font-size: 14px;
	display: block;
	-webkit-transition: all 0.25s ease;
	-o-transition: all 0.25s ease;
	transition: all 0.25s ease;
	padding-left: 24px;
}

.submenu a:before {
	font-family: 'Font Awesome 6 Pro';
	font-weight: 300;
	line-height: 50px;
	position: absolute;
	z-index: 1;
	top: 0;
	left: 0px;
	width: 15px;
	height: 50px;
	margin-top: 0;
	content: '\e404';
	text-decoration: inherit;
	color: #022341;
	/*	background: red;*/
}

.submenu a:hover {
	/*  background: #FBED21;*/
}

.accordion::-webkit-scrollbar {
	width: 20px;
	border-radius: 50px;
}

.accordion::-webkit-scrollbar-track {
	background: #fff;
	border-radius: 50px;
}

.accordion::-webkit-scrollbar-thumb {
	background-color: #000;
	border-radius: 50px;
}